Optimal performance of injection-molded parts requires decisions regarding material selection, mold design, and part design to be made holistically. However, the influence of manufacturing on performance is typically limited to weld line placement. This presentation highlights how manufacturing decisions will influence the short and long-term performance of the part.

Erik Foltz is a Certified Professional Moldflow® Consultant. He received his M.S. from the Polymer Engineering Center at the University of Wisconsin – Madison. His specialties include plastic part design verification, process optimization and troubleshooting for injection and compression molding, and plastics failure. He has experience with thermoplastic, thermoset, elastomeric, and composite materials.
